Subject: Quillfeed key rotation — action needed before Thursday's release

Hey Priya,

Quick note: we're rotating the service keys for Quillfeed, the markdown rendering pipeline, ahead of Thursday's cut. The old key stops working at rotation time, so the release pipeline's render step will fail unless you swap it in the deploy config first. Everything else stays the same. The new key for the render service is below.

gateway credential: kto3_qfe

Reviewer notes. Receiptwren sends donation receipts for the Hollowvale giving platform. One worker, one queue. Receipts are idempotent on donation ID — reject any PR that breaks that. Templates live in the `letterforms` repo; rendering happens at send time, not enqueue time. Retries: three, exponential backoff, then dead-letter. PDFs are generated by the internal Stampery service; all calls to it must go through the shared client, never raw requests. Staging Stampery auth is required for review builds; the key is below.

API key for tagef-fafop: vxb2-ta

# Legacy ORM refactor — Grindstone data layer
#
# These constants govern the shim between the old Grindstone ORM and the
# new repository classes. Batch sizes and cache TTLs were chosen to match
# the legacy behaviour exactly during the migration window; do not tune
# them for performance yet. Contractors: changes here require sign-off
# from the data-layer owner. The shim reads the following values at
# startup, listed below.

tuning constants:
QUOTAS = {
    "druwyn": 5,
    "holix": 5,
    "zorath": 5,
    "holwyn": 10,
}